Specifications
- Wire: Nichrome, 30 AWG
- Power:
- 9 V AC, supplied by attached 120 V A adapter
- Cut depth: 4.5"
- Cut throat: 5.5" (officially 6", but measured as 5.5")
Operation & safety
Be careful! The hot wire is under tension while cutting. If it overheats, it could break and throw molten nichrome at you. |
Plug it in. It heats up. Pass it through foam to cut.
